Russia sanctioned British political leaders and analysts after Moscow accused London of maintaining hostile policies. The Foreign Ministry targeted individuals who support stronger economic restrictions against Russia and participate in anti-Russian activities. Officials named James Byrne from the Open Source Center, Anna Deibel-Jung from trade sanctions, Scottish National Party lawmaker David Doogan and Foreign Office official Max Petrokofsky among those affected. Treasury personnel also faced penalties.
Moscow claims Britain seeks Russia's strategic defeat through Ukrainian forces while spreading anti-Russian propaganda. The ministry warned that British efforts to isolate Russia would receive strong retaliation. Russian officials plan to expand their sanctions list further as tensions escalate between the nations.
